DESCRIPTION:On January 28 and 29\, 2026\, Aterballetto performs Notte Morricone by Marcos Morau at Theater Gütersloh in Germany.\n“I\, Ennio Morricone\, am dead\,” wrote the composer before taking his leave. His music\, however\, cannot die. This is how creators and artists always leave us without ever truly leaving\, and how memory takes care to keep them alive\, to keep them safe. Notte Morricone is my gift\, a devoted tribute to the beauty he gave to the world.Notte Morricone unfolds in the twilight of an ordinary night in the life of a creative spirit who\, alone and dazed before his papers\, jots down notes and envisions melodies for films that do not yet exist\, bringing stories back to life in the rarefied air of his room.Marcos Morau – Director and Choreographer \nIt is impossible to describe Notte Morricone\, a masterful work that washes over the spectator in waves\, embraces them with emotional currents\, and captivates them with the memory of timeless melodies that have long outlived the images that first inspired them. Equally enchanting is the finely chiselled\, ever-poetic choreography\, composed with meticulous attention to detail: legs and necks seem jointless\, bending and snapping rhythmically like metronomes.Maria Luisa Buzzi – Danza&Danza \nDuration: 90 minutesFind out more » \n

DESCRIPTION:Il Combattimento di Tancredi e Clorinda arrives at Palazzo Bentivoglio in Gualtieri.\n \nSunday\, January 25\, 20263:00 PM and 5:00 PM \n \nThe Fondazione Museo Antonio Ligabue has a dream: to transform the Salone dei Giganti of Palazzo Bentivoglio into a living theatre. More than that\, it envisions the frescoes depicting scenes from Gerusalemme liberata by Torquato Tasso coming to life through the dance of Il Combattimento di Tancredi e Clorinda\, curated by the Centro Coreografico Nazionale / Aterballetto. \n \nThis is not just a performance. It is a one-of-a-kind site-specific event. The Sala dei Giganti houses the very frescoes that narrate the tragic duel between Tancredi and Clorinda. Painted art and performing art will face each other directly.Myth will become flesh\, breath\, and movement. \nWould you like to help make this ambitious dream a reality and become part of the myth?\n \n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\nJoin the crowdfunding campaign here! \n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n  \nhttps://youtu.be/mjZQdcn1fgc \n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\nThe theme of love overwhelmed by war and death\, inspired by the story of Tancredi and Clorinda as told by Torquato Tasso in Gerusalemme Liberata (whose 450th anniversary of its first draft falls in 2025) and set to music by Claudio Monteverdi (1624)\, retains a striking relevance today. \nThe CCN/Aterballetto interprets this legacy through dance—its privileged language for conveying the work’s intensity and dramatic power—in a performance created by Fabio Cherstich and Philippe Kratz\, performed by dancers Alessia Giacomelli and Kiran Gezels\, tenor Matteo Straffi\, and harpsichordist Deniel Perer. \nThe performance is preceded and followed by talks by Antonio Audino\, theatre critic and journalist for Radio Rai 3\, who\, with his characteristic clarity\, will cast a contemporary light on what are considered “sacred texts” of Italy’s cultural heritage. \n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n  \nCREDITS \n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\nDirection and visuals: Fabio CherstichChoreography and stage movement: Philippe KratzMusic: Il Combattimento di Tancredi e Clorinda by Claudio MonteverdiDancers: Alessia Giacomelli\, Kiran GezelsSinger (tenor): Matteo StraffiHarpsichord: Deniel Perer \nCo-production: Fondazione Nazionale della Danza / Aterballetto\, Teatro Regio di Parma / Festival Verdi\, Torinodanza Festival – Teatro Stabile di Torino – Teatro Nazionale\, GhislieriMusica – Centro di Musica Antica \nPremiered in September 2024\, Il Combattimento di Tancredi e Clorinda is a project aimed at enhancing live performance activities within cultural institutions and heritage sites\, promoted by the Directorate General for Museums and co-funded by the Directorate General for Performing Arts. \nFor the realization of the project\, the National Museums of Perugia – Regional Directorate of National Museums of Umbria—and in particular the National Archaeological Museum and Roman Theatre of Spoleto—established\, with the support of the Directorate General for Museums\, a partnership shared with five other major cultural sites: Villa Pisani in Stra\, the Castle and Park of Racconigi\, the Castello Svevo in Bari\, the Certosa di San Martino in Naples\, and the Archaeological Park of Venosa.Castel Sant’Angelo in Rome later joined the project\, hosting the initiative as part of the summer program Sotto l’angelo di Castello 2024. \n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n \n  \nThe project is part of Italia Danza\, a co-designed initiative by the Directorate General for Public and Cultural Diplomacy of the Italian Ministry of Foreign Affairs (MAECI) and CCN/Aterballetto\, aimed at promoting Italy’s artistic heritage abroad. \nBODIES AS MIRRORS \n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\nIn my vision of Il Combattimento di Tancredi e Clorinda\, I imagine a confined\, circular space\, where the proximity and resemblance of bodies play a fundamental role. Together with choreographer Philippe Kratz\, we explore the idea of bodies as mirrors\, thus narrating an humanity struggling against itself. Eros and Thanatos emerge as equally powerful forces\, creating a paradoxical atmosphere in this perfectly balanced struggle between human beings.In our vision\, Tancredi and Clorinda are contemporary warriors\, indissolubly bound to one another\, forced to fight and to enact a story that has already been written. \nA single voice brings three characters to life: the text itself\, Tancredi\, and Clorinda merge into the body and sound of a single singer. This estranged sound\, constrained within a circular path\, creates a sense of constant repetition\, underscoring the endless cycle of this story of love and death—tragically destined to repeat itself through the centuries and reach us today with all its force\, as an emanation of the poetic power of Tasso’s words and the sublime music of Monteverdi. \nFabio Cherstich\, Director \n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\nINNER STRUGGLE \n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\nIn Tasso’s narrative\, set to music by Claudio Monteverdi\, the most obvious themes are the struggle between woman and man and religious conversion. Yet these are also the aspects I find least intriguing: translating them into dance would risk reducing the work to a narrative of factual circumstances. \nA more philosophical or psychoanalytic reading of this struggle—one from which both protagonists emerge defeated\, deceived\, and alone—appears far more compelling to me. Within the opposition of the two roles there already exists an entire world: seeking one another\, confronting one another\, and wounding one another. The dynamic is that of a warlike\, conflictual ritual between two entities that draw closer. The absurdity of the act becomes evident when one of the two loses their life and we realize that the other\, in any case\, has not won… a deep\, shared wound that remains on both bodies. \nSo are these two people fighting each other\, or is it perhaps one person struggling with themselves? \nPhilippe Kratz\, Choreographer \n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n  \n

DESCRIPTION:At the Teatro Cristallo in Bolzano\, Aterballetto performs Dreamers\, a triptych featuring choreographies by Tortelli\, Kratz\, and Pite.\nDreamers is a choreographic journey through three visions\, three distinct poetics\, which together form a single reflection on desire\, memory\, loss\, and the strength of the body as an emotional and spiritual space. Three creations by some of the most significant choreographers on the contemporary scene — Philippe Kratz\, Crystal Pite\, and Diego Tortelli — unfold like chapters of a single dream. \nIn An echo\, a wave\, Philippe Kratz draws inspiration from the sea as a metaphor for eternity\, for encounter and separation. The waves\, like the dancers’ bodies\, carry with them stories\, emotions\, and continuous movement\, in a flow that recalls the endless departures and returns of our existence. The Mediterranean thus becomes a mirror of our ephemeral nature\, yet also of our capacity for beauty and connection. \n© Festival de Granada | Fermín Rodríguez \nWith Preludio\, Diego Tortelli creates a love letter to the body—its fragility and its strength\, its constant state of transformation. Through the poetic and musical universe of Nick Cave\, the work explores personal “creed\,” the human need to give meaning and shape to emotions. On stage\, the dancers are not individuals but emotional pulsations\, inhabiting space with urgency and lyricism. \nFND/Aterballetto – Preludio – ph. Claudio Montanari \nSolo Echo by Crystal Pite is inspired by two sonatas for cello and piano by Johannes Brahms and by the profound verses of Mark Strand. On stage\, one breathes the winter of the soul: time slows down\, and the body becomes a vessel for a moving and powerful introspection. With delicacy and intensity\, Pite reflects on the themes of loss\, the acceptance of change\, and the mystery of resilience. \n  \n\nDreamers is an encounter between three ways of sensing and narrating the world—an invitation to let oneself be carried by dance as a lucid dream\, a mirror of our most intimate tensions\, a memory of our deepest desires.

DESCRIPTION:  \nMaurizio Cattelan Bidibidobidiboo 1996 photo Zeno Zotti copia (Palazzo Grassi\, Venezia) \nAt PARC in Florence\, three works by Maurizio Cattelan are the focus of the new edition of Visioni del corpo — discovering contemporary art through the lens of choreographic creation.\n  \n\n\n\n\n\n\n\nNicolas Ballario\, listed among the 100 most influential figures in the art world by Il Giornale dell’Arte\, guides the audience through the history and poetics of Maurizio Cattelan\, one of the most renowned and controversial contemporary Italian artists on the international scene. \nAt the heart of the evening are three of Cattelan’s works — irreverent and provocative pieces that challenge art and society with sharp irony and striking visual power. \nChoreographer Lara Guidetti\, together with CCN/Aterballetto dancers Alessia Giacomelli and Kiran Gezels\, gives body and movement to Cattelan’s visions\, transforming the irony\, paradox\, and silence of his works into physical gesture. \nThe three choreographic pieces created for this evening stem from works that are vastly different from one another\, compelling the dancers to inhabit ever-changing physical grammars: from physical theatre to abstract form\, from extreme restraint to the poetic power of the mask. The challenge is not to create a stylistic continuum\, but to generate radical metamorphoses that free the performers from the traces of the author and lead them into unforeseen territories. \nOn stage\, images intertwine\, oscillating between beauty and rawness: a Milan that resembles a factory farm of unconscious bodies\, a child on the verge of becoming a monster\, an ordinary man facing a gun. It is dance that recomposes these fragmented visions\, restoring unity to what is dissonant — turning each artwork into a physical experience and each vision into a living presence. \n\n\n\n\n\n\n\nMaurizio Cattelan\, Him\, 2001\, ph Tom Lindboe (Blenheim) A \n  \n\nLara Guidetti \n\n\n\n\n\n\n\nIn 2006\, Lara Guidetti graduated as a dancer and choreographer from the Theatre-Dance Atelier of the Paolo Grassi School in Milan\, studying with leading national and international masters. She continued her education in dance and performing arts by exploring various pedagogical and training methods through workshops and productions. \nIn 2008\, she founded the Sanpapié Company\, where she serves as artistic director\, choreographer\, director\, and performer\, presenting works across Italy\, Europe\, China\, and Saudi Arabia. In 2017\, her performance LEI won the Bonacina Prize. \nShe collaborates with the JGM Company in Lisbon and with La Scala Theatre in Milan as a dancer and acrobat\, and she has created choreography for several opera productions. She has also taught at the Paolo Grassi School\, DanceHaus Milano\, and the Teatro Stabile di Torino School. \nSince 2022\, she has been an associated artist at the MilanOltre Festival and a collaborator with CCN/Aterballetto as a choreographer and curator of site-specific and cultural welfare projects. \n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n  \nNicolas Ballario \n\n\n\n\n\n\n\nBorn in Saluzzo in 1984\, Nicolas Ballario works in the field of contemporary art applied to the media. His professional career began in Oliviero Toscani’s creative factory\, “La Sterpaia\,” where he went on to become cultural director. \nHe has collaborated with major artistic institutions and numerous publications. He is currently the author and host of contemporary art programs on Radio Uno Rai\, and a contributor to L’Espresso and Il Giornale dell’Arte. \nIn 2019\, he hosted the photography series “Camera Oscura” on LA7\, and since 2020 he has led several Sky Arte programs\, including “Io ti vedo\, tu mi senti?”\, “The Square\,” and “Italia Contemporanea.” \nHe is also the founder of Studio Cucù and curated the dossier that led to Alba being named Italian Capital of Contemporary Art 2027. \n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n \n  \n
